What You'll Do
- Partner closely with Engineering, Product, Operations, Support, and other key leaders to establish project scope, timeline, technical direction, and success metrics for projects. Projects will include building new product features, expanding platform capability, and tooling enhancements that will improve customers' experience or engineering velocity.
- Deliver Engineering objectives by executing the projects and providing visibility to resource allocation and prioritization. Develop frameworks for execution and adapt to the team’s needs & context.
- Develop a full understanding of our technical stack and interdependencies, and contribute to designs to ensure they are scalable, reliable, and efficient.
- Track, prioritize, and execute projects, enhancements, or bugs from the team backlog.
- Manage timely and succinct communications to leadership and across teams to ensure accountability and timeline management.
- Document project artifacts, including work steps, deployments, release notes, and monthly reporting.
- Perform user-acceptance testing and coordinate releases.
- After project completion, facilitate retrospective meetings.

Vail Systems, Inc. Compensation & Benefits Highlights
-
Healthcare Strength — Medical, dental, and vision options span multiple BCBSIL and Cigna plans with prescription coverage, EAP access, FSAs/HSAs, and transgender‑inclusive care. Onsite or affiliated gym access and wellness programming complement the core coverage.
-
Parental & Family Support — Paid parental leave provides 12 weeks for primary caregivers and 2 weeks for secondary caregivers, alongside adoption assistance and fertility benefits within health plans. An onsite Mother’s Room and childcare/family medical leave further reinforce family support.
-
Leave & Time Off Breadth — Time off combines 15 PTO days, 3 float days, and 5 paid sick/wellness days, plus paid holidays. Limited rollover of PTO and sick hours adds flexibility in managing time away.
